Abstract

Technological developments and lifestyle changes following the COVID-19 pandemic have increased the prevalence of sedentary behavior in young adults, potentially negatively impacting cognitive function. Physical activity interventions, particularly High-Intensity Interval Training (HIIT), are known to have benefits for brain health. Pound Fit is a form of HIIT that combines high-intensity exercise, rhythmic music, and motor coordination, but empirical evidence regarding its effects on cognitive function in sedentary young adults is still limited. This study aims to analyze the effectiveness of HIIT through Pound Fit on cognitive function in young adults with a sedentary lifestyle. This study used a Randomized Controlled Trial (RCT) design with a quantitative approach. The MoCA-Ina has been reported to have good construct validity and high reliability with a Cronbach's Alpha value >0.70, making it considered reliable for measuring cognitive function in the Indonesian population. A total of 40 female Nursing students with a sedentary lifestyle were recruited and randomly divided into an intervention group (n=20) and a control group (n=20). The intervention group participated in a HIIT-based Pound Fit exercise program for four weeks (3 times/week, ±45 minutes/session), while the control group carried out their usual activities. Cognitive function was measured using the Indonesian version of the Montreal Cognitive Assessment (MoCA-Ina) before and after the intervention. Data analysis was performed using a Paired Samples t-test and an Independent Samples t-test . The results of the paired samples t-test showed a significant increase in cognitive function in the intervention group after Pound Fit exercise (p < 0.001). The independent samples t-test also showed a significant difference in cognitive function scores between the intervention group and the control group in the posttest measurement (p < 0.001). All data met the assumptions of normality and homogeneity. HIIT training through Pound Fit exercise has been proven effective in improving cognitive function in young adults with a sedentary lifestyle. This intervention has the potential to be an applicable promotive and preventive strategy in nursing and public health practice to support the cognitive health of young adults.

Abstract

Background : Musculoskeletal disorders (MSDs) represent a major occupational health concern among agricultural workers in Indonesia. These conditions commonly arise from repetitive workloads, awkward or non-ergonomic body positions, and insufficient understanding of ergonomic practices. As a result, farmers may experience ongoing discomfort, reduced work capacity, and a decline in overall well-being. Objective : The purpose of this study was to assess the effectiveness of an Ergonomics Exercise Program (EEP) in alleviating musculoskeletal complaints among farmers. Methods : This study applied a pre- and post-intervention design involving 85 farmers. Symptoms related to musculoskeletal disorders were evaluated before and after the intervention using the Visual Analog Scale (VAS) and the Nordic Body Map (NBM). The Ergonomics Exercise Program was carried out over a two-week period, with participants performing 10-minute exercise sessions each day prior to starting work. The intervention focused on flexibility training, strengthening of core muscles, and correction of working posture. Changes in MSD symptoms were analyzed statistically to determine the effect of the program. Results : Before the intervention, 54% of participants reported mild pain, while 46% experienced moderate pain levels. The most commonly affected body areas included the calves (62.3%), lower back (45.8%), arms (40%), and shoulders (28.2%). Following the implementation of the Ergonomics Exercise Program, a statistically significant reduction in musculoskeletal complaints was observed (p < 0.05), particularly in the lower back, shoulders, and calves. Conclusion : The findings indicate that the Ergonomics Exercise Program effectively reduced musculoskeletal disorder symptoms among farmers. Incorporating ergonomics-based exercise routines into agricultural nursing and occupational health initiatives may offer a practical and sustainable approach to improving worker health and preventing MSDs in rural farming populations in Indonesia.

Abstract

Background: Pre-elderly individuals often suffer from hypertension, a chronic condition that often causes anxiety due to increased sympathetic nervous system activity. By increasing parasympathetic activity and muscle relaxation, non-pharmacological techniques such as Progressive Muscle Relaxation (PMR) and Slow Breathing Exercises (SBE) have been shown to reduce anxiety levels. Objective: The purpose of this study was to determine the impact of progressive muscle relaxation and slow breathing exercises on anxiety levels in pre-elderly individuals with hypertension in Depok Village, Pakenjeng District, Garut Regency. Methods: This study used a quasi-experimental, non-randomized pre-post-test design with two groups (intervention vs. control). 100 pre-elderly participants were selected using purposive sampling. The intervention lasted for one month and consisted of two 30-minute sessions per week. The Hamilton Anxiety Rating Scale (HARS) was used to assess anxiety symptoms. Results were analyzed statistically using the paired samples t test and the independent samples t test for samples with a significance level of p < 0.05. Results: The results of the study found that after the intervention, anxiety scores in the intervention group decreased significantly from a mean of 27.88 (SD 8.47) to a mean of 12.80 (SD 4.82) (p < 0.001), with a substantial effect size (Cohen's d = 2.21). In the control group, the decrease from a mean of 28.82 (SD 9.10) to a mean of 21.94 (SD 7.18) was less pronounced. A significant difference remained between the two groups after the intervention (mean difference = 9.14; 95% CI: 6.72–11.56; p < 0.001), indicating that the combination of SBE and PMR was effective in reducing anxiety. Conclusion: The combination of slow breathing exercises and progressive muscle relaxation is effective in reducing anxiety levels in pre-elderly people with hypertension. This intervention can be recommended as a non-pharmacological supportive therapy in public health services.

Abstract

Background: Pressure ulcers remain a prevalent and preventable complication among bedridden patients, with manual repositioning every two hours established as the clinical standard of prevention. This practice places substantial physical demands on nurses and informal caregivers, contributing to high rates of work-related musculoskeletal disorders, including low back pain, among those performing repetitive turning tasks. Despite the availability of various assistive devices, most have been developed without systematic assessment of the combined needs of both patients and caregivers as dual users. Objective: This review aimed to identify clinical, ergonomic, and functional needs for a patient repositioning device among bedridden patients and their caregivers through synthesis of existing literature. Methods: A literature review was conducted using Scopus, PubMed, and EBSCO, covering publications from 2016 to 2024. Articles published in English addressing repositioning practices, assistive device design or evaluation, caregiver ergonomics, or pressure injury prevention in immobile patients were included. Studies unrelated to repositioning function or device ergonomics were excluded. Eight articles met the inclusion criteria and were included in the final synthesis. Results: Three primary need domains were consistently identified across the reviewed literature. First, bedridden patients require effective pressure redistribution to prevent tissue injury during prolonged immobility. Second, caregivers need a reduction in biomechanical workload during repositioning, particularly in lumbar and shoulder loading. Third, the device must offer usability features that enable safe, consistent positioning without requiring multiple personnel or specialized training. Current assistive devices inadequately address all three domains simultaneously, with most designs optimizing for one dimension at the expense of others. Conclusion: Bedridden patients and their caregivers present distinct yet interdependent needs that must be jointly addressed in ergonomic repositioning device development. A dual-user design framework integrating pressure redistribution, biomechanical efficiency, and practical usability represents a critical direction for future nursing research and device innovation.
